Sky Sports Report United's Bid For Schneiderlin On Hold
Tuesday, 30th Jun 2015 14:14

Sky Sports are reporting that sources close to Manchester United are reporting that the Old Trafford Club have put the deal on hold.

According to Sky Sports United have not contacted Saints about Schneiderlin since an initial enquiry on 20th June some 10 days ago despite the fact that betting was suspended on the transfer so sure where the bookmakers that this deal was very close to fruition.

Earlier today this site speculated that Schneidferlin might not be United's number 1 target and that they may be hedging their bets on the Saints midfielder whilst persuing their other preferred targets including Bastian Sweinsteiger.

The evidence this afternoon is suggesting that this could be the case with United stepping back from the plate but not withdrawing themselves from the deal completely, in many ways this replicates their chasing of Nathaniel Clyne were at one stage the right back seemed destined for Old Trafford but suddenly United seemed to cool on the idea.

This is of course leaving Schneiderlin in limbo, but more worryingly Saints, who are keen to get on with their own squad building.
